agricultural chemistry
The use of chemical substances for agricultural purposes; such as, enrichment of the soil, destruction of insect pests, and the control of plant and animal diseases.

agricultural chemistry
The field of science in which chemicals are used to increase the quality or amount of farm crops produced.
synthetic fertilizers, pesticides, and herbicides (weed-killers) are examples of such chemicals.
